# Break-Glass: Catalog Cache Invalidation

Scope: the Pinrow product catalog at Veldstone Retail. If stale prices persist after a purge and the Hollowmere invalidation queue is wedged, use break-glass to flush the edge tier directly. Contractors: get verbal sign-off from the catalog lead first. Steps: open the Hollowmere admin shell, select emergency-flush, confirm the tenant, and run it once — repeated flushes thrash the origin. Access is logged and expires after 20 minutes. Unseal the admin shell with the passphrase below.

recovery phrase for kahop-tajog: istix-casvan

**Postmortem timeline — Kestrelbase partition incident**

02:14 — Monthly partition for the ledger table failed to create; inserts for the new month rejected.
02:21 — On-call paged; writes queued in Drayhall buffer.
02:40 — Partition created manually; backlog drained by 03:05.
Root cause: partition-maintenance job lacked schema privileges after the access tightening. No data exposure; queued rows encrypted at rest. The job build involved is recorded below.

build token for tawip-yageg: htk9_92ac43d42

# Session Handling — ProctorQueue

Each invigilator session in ProctorQueue is bound to a single queue shard and expires after 30 minutes of inactivity. Refreshing early is safe; the Halvane gateway deduplicates refresh requests within a 5-second window. Note that session revocation propagates asynchronously, so a revoked session may succeed on reads for up to 10 seconds. For this week's sync demo against the staging shard, authenticate every request with the bearer token provided below.

portal login ticket: eyJhbGciOiJIUzI1NiIsInR5cCI6IkpXVCJ9.eyJzdWIiOiIwEOsktwVNwIn0.-UJU3fdyyCgG